> Subject: [PATCH v2 RESEND 1/2] usb: dwc3: core: configure TX/RX threshold for
> DWC3_IP
> 
> In Synopsys's dwc3 data book:
> To avoid underrun and overrun during the burst, in a high-latency bus system
> (like USB), threshold and burst size control is provided through GTXTHRCFG and
> GRXTHRCFG registers.
> 
> In Realtek DHC SoC, DWC3 USB 3.0 uses AHB system bus. When dwc3 is
> connected with USB 2.5G Ethernet, there will be overrun problem.
> Therefore, setting TX/RX thresholds can avoid this issue.

> diff --git a/drivers/usb/dwc3/core.c b/drivers/usb/dwc3/core.c index
> 9c6bf054f15d..1f74a53816c3 100644
> --- a/drivers/usb/dwc3/core.c
> +++ b/drivers/usb/dwc3/core.c
> @@ -1246,6 +1246,39 @@ static int dwc3_core_init(struct dwc3 *dwc)
>  		}
>  	}
> 
> +	if (DWC3_IP_IS(DWC3)) {
> +		u8 rx_thr_num = dwc->rx_thr_num_pkt;
> +		u8 rx_maxburst = dwc->rx_max_burst;
> +		u8 tx_thr_num = dwc->tx_thr_num_pkt;
> +		u8 tx_maxburst = dwc->tx_max_burst;
> +
> +		if (rx_thr_num && rx_maxburst) {
> +			reg = dwc3_readl(dwc->regs, DWC3_GRXTHRCFG);
> +			reg |= DWC3_GRXTHRCFG_PKTCNTSEL;
> +
> +			reg &= ~DWC3_GRXTHRCFG_RXPKTCNT(~0);
> +			reg |= DWC3_GRXTHRCFG_RXPKTCNT(rx_thr_num);
> +
> +			reg &= ~DWC3_GRXTHRCFG_MAXRXBURSTSIZE(~0);
> +			reg |= DWC3_GRXTHRCFG_MAXRXBURSTSIZE(rx_maxburst);
> +
> +			dwc3_writel(dwc->regs, DWC3_GRXTHRCFG, reg);
> +		}
> +
> +		if (tx_thr_num && tx_maxburst) {
> +			reg = dwc3_readl(dwc->regs, DWC3_GTXTHRCFG);
> +			reg |= DWC3_GTXTHRCFG_PKTCNTSEL;
> +
> +			reg &= ~DWC3_GTXTHRCFG_TXPKTCNT(~0);
> +			reg |= DWC3_GTXTHRCFG_TXPKTCNT(tx_thr_num);
> +
> +			reg &= ~DWC3_GTXTHRCFG_MAXTXBURSTSIZE(~0);
> +			reg |= DWC3_GTXTHRCFG_MAXTXBURSTSIZE(tx_maxburst);
> +
> +			dwc3_writel(dwc->regs, DWC3_GTXTHRCFG, reg);
> +		}
> +	}
> +
>  	return 0;
